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Designer Brands Inc. director John W. Atkinson received a grant of 26,527 stock units as board compensation. Each stock unit represents the right to receive one Class A common share. The grant vests immediately and will convert into an equal number of shares when he leaves the Board, with totals including accrued dividend equivalent rights. After this award, he holds 121,093 stock units directly.

Class A common stock is a category of a company’s shares that carries a specific set of ownership rights—most commonly defined voting power and claims on dividends—set out in the company’s charter. For investors it matters because the class determines how much influence you have over corporate decisions, the share’s likely dividend and trading behavior, and how it compares in value to other share classes, like choosing a particular seat with different privileges at the company’s decision-making table.

Dividend equivalent rights are promises that mirror the cash payments shareholders get from a company’s profits, but they are paid to holders of certain awards (like stock options or restricted stock units) rather than to actual shares. Think of them as a paycheck top‑up that matches dividends while the award is not yet a real stock, and they matter to investors because they add to employee compensation costs and potential share dilution, affecting company profitability and per‑share value.

FAQ

What did Designer Brands (DBI) director John W. Atkinson report on this Form 4?

John W. Atkinson reported receiving 26,527 stock units as board compensation. These stock units are a form of deferred equity that convert into Class A common shares when his Board service ends, aligning his interests with shareholders over the long term.

How many stock units does John W. Atkinson now hold in Designer Brands (DBI)?

After the reported grant, John W. Atkinson directly holds a total of 121,093 stock units. This figure includes the new 26,527-unit award and reflects accrued dividend equivalent rights that increase the number of units over time.

What does each stock unit represent for Designer Brands (DBI) insiders?

Each stock unit represents a contingent right to receive one share of Designer Brands’ Class A common stock. The units are typically used as non-cash compensation, providing future shares instead of immediate stock or cash payments to directors or executives.

When will John W. Atkinson’s stock units in Designer Brands (DBI) convert into shares?

The stock units become vested on the grant date but convert into Class A common shares only when John W. Atkinson’s service on the Board of Directors ends. This deferred conversion helps encourage longer-term alignment with shareholders’ interests.

What are dividend equivalent rights on Designer Brands (DBI) stock units?

Dividend equivalent rights increase the number of stock units to mirror dividends paid on Class A common shares. Instead of cash, additional units accrue, so the total reported units for John W. Atkinson include these dividend-based adjustments over time.
